Target Your Tummy: Effective Workouts for Stomach Fat Loss
Losing tummy fat can feel like an uphill battle. But don't worry, you're not alone! Many people struggle with this frequently occurring goal. The good news is that with the right approach, you can successfully target those stubborn pounds and reveal a toned midsection. It all starts with a combination of effective workouts and healthy eating habits.
- Include cardio exercises like running, swimming, or cycling to burn calories and boost your metabolism.
- Tone your core muscles with exercises such as planks, crunches, and Russian twists. A strong core supports overall stability and can make a big difference in how your stomach area appears.
- Remember that spot reduction is a myth. You can't directly focus on fat loss in one area.
Sculpt a Slimmer Waistline: Exercise Guide to Burning Belly Fat
Want to flaunt a more sculpted waistline? Eliminating belly fat can seem like a daunting task, but with the right exercise routine and dedication, you can achieve your goals. Here's a guide to help you get started:
- Cardiovascular Exercise: Engage in at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io most days. This could include brisk walking, running, swimming, or cycling.
- Core Training: Incorporate exercises that target your abdominal muscles like crunches, planks, and leg raises. Aim for 2-3 sessions per week.
- HIIT Workouts: High-intensity interval training (HIIT) involves quick bursts of exercise followed by brief recovery periods. This method is highly effective for burning calories and boosting your metabolism.
Remember to consult your doctor before starting any new exercise program, especially if you have underlying health conditions. Listen to your body, rest when needed, and be patient. With consistent effort, you'll be on your way to a slimmer waistline and improved overall fitness.
